### Key Ceremony Checklist — Item 7: Billing Worker Cutover

New folks: during the ceremony, verify the Thistledown billing worker's blue-green deploy before key activation. Confirm green is serving shadow traffic, ledgers on both colors reconcile to the cent, and rollback scripts are staged. Only then flip the router. To unseal the ceremony workstation for this step, enter the passphrase listed below.

unlock words, kawig-bawef: belax-sorir-druax-ulaiel-wenael-belael

Notes from Monday's briefing: the label panels for the new Marlowe Wing are printed and shrink-wrapped on pallet two, aisle C. Count is 148 pieces plus ten spares. The gallery team needs them Friday at the latest. Shift lead to have them staged by Thursday close; courier hand-over instruction follows below.

handover note for yagef-bagep: the drudor pelius courier leaves the kasdor zorvan norir ledger at gate 8016 under passcode 755406

External plugin authors normally cannot modify the Varrow static-analysis baseline, which records accepted findings for all published plugins. In rare cases — a false positive blocking a critical release — the break-glass path lets you suppress a finding directly. Use it sparingly; every edit is logged and reviewed within one business day. The break-glass endpoint sits behind an isolated gateway and will not accept your normal credentials. Instead, authenticate with the passphrase provided immediately below.

unlock words, kagef-taduf: fenir-quenix-norwyn-sorvan-gormir-gorir-fraok

## Step 4: Enable idempotency keys

Paybrook retries now require idempotency keys on every charge call. Missing keys cause duplicate settlements under retry storms. Generate keys client-side, one per logical payment attempt, and reuse on retry. Do not regenerate on timeout. The Ledgerline gateway dedupes within a 24-hour window; anything older is treated as new. Flip the enforcement flag only after all callers send keys. Apply the following configuration to the retry worker before enabling enforcement.

config for kafof-bawef:
holath:
  log_level: debug
  metrics_host: metrics.holath.qorvelsys.internal
  pin: 2191
  pool_size: 32